Product Information

Pull out the black NEC TurboExpress handheld system for a ton of retro gaming fun. This portable gaming console was first released in 1990. It offered gamers a way to take their favorite Turbografx-16 console games with them wherever they went, including 'Bonk's Revenge,' 'Keith Courage,' and 'Neutopia.' This system features a 481-color and 2.6 inch screen. It can display up to 64 sprites at a time with up to 16 sprites per scan line. It has up to 8 kilobytes of RAM and can run its 6820 CPU at 3.58 or 7.16 megahertz. As a vintage handheld gaming system, the TurboExpress is great for a collector or someone who still has a bunch of old game cards that are just asking to be played.

  • TURBOEXPRESS- GOLD RATED HANDHELD OF THE RETRO AGE & FOR FUTURE GENERATIONS

    The TurboExpress is a handheld video game console, released by NEC Home Electronics in 1990. It is essentially a portable version of the TurboGrafx-16/PC Engine home console that came two to three years earlier. It was sold as the PC Engine GT (Game Tank)[citation needed] in Japan. 1.5 Million of these units were sold after the launch of the handheld. At the time the unit competed with Sega Game Gear, Nintendo Game Boy , & Atari Lynx. The unit was clearly underrated and is clear the BEST HANDHELD of the Retro.
